Ingredients:  
Ingredients:  
10 qts field tomatoes (or any other choice)
12 med onions
2 bunches celery chopped
4 chopped green peppers
3 tbsp salt
1 tsp ground cloves
1 qt white vinegar
4 hot red peppers
4 lbs white sugar
1 tsp allspice
1 tsp pepper

Directions:
Directions:
Chop and mix all ingredients
Cook over med heat for 3-4 hours stirring occasionally so there is no sticking .
When reduced to your liking place in sterilizes jars and seal,
Enjoy
Great for szechuan shrimp or scrambled eggs too!
